This Print represents the Monument in Guildhall of the City of London, in Commemoration of Admiral Lord Visct Nelson

Technique includes aquatinting.

A detailed drawing of the monument to Nelson in the Guildhall of the City of London. There was a genuine outpouring of national grief following the news of Nelson's death at the victorious Battle of Trafalgar on 21 October 1805. Many monuments were erected to the great naval hero.
